Logan Duderstadt featured in PGA Magazine
PGA of America summer interns reflect upon a busy and rewarding summer.
- by Bob Baal
For the fourth consecutive year, The PGA of America National Office welcomed a quartet of summer interns who hail from accredited PGA Golf Management University Programs. Throughout their 12-week experience at The PGA’s Headquarters in Palm Beach Gardens, Fla., these students provided assistance on a wide range of projects and events, including Golf 2.0, player development, communications and public relations, and membership services.
The 2012 class of interns included: Stephen Limpach, a senior at North Carolina State University; Luke Luttrell, a graduating senior (December, 2012) at the University of Idaho; Brooke Rodes, a graduating senior (December, 2012) at Ferris State University; and Logan Duderstadt, a senior at Eastern Kentucky University. The four were chosen from a wide range of applicants representing all 20 PGA Golf Management University Programs, and upon arrival they were each assigned to specific PGA departments.
